Source Setup file Frequency sets Observing hours (duplicates not shown) Scan Baseline FAKERA ra18cm2.set 12 4.083 0.000 3C286 ra18cm2.set 1 2 3 4 5 6 7 8 11 13 14 25 0.883 55.135 3C84 ra18cm2.set 25 0.083 3.750 ra6cm2.set 45 0.067 3.000 ra4cm2.set 15 0.083 3.750 ra2cm2.set 35 0.100 4.500 OJ287 ra18cm2.set 25 1.000 29.800 ra6cm2.set 45 0.767 21.933 ra4cm2.set 15 0.944 28.967 ra2cm2.set 35 1.256 34.817 1641+399 ra18cm2.set 1 2 3 4 5 6 7 8 11 13 14 25 + 10.694 1261.236 ra6cm2.set 45 0.333 15.000 ra4cm2.set 15 0.417 18.750 ra2cm2.set 35 0.500 22.475 EFFECT OF SOLAR CORONA The solar corona can cause unstable phases for sources too close to the Sun. SCHED provides warnings at individual scans for distances less than 10 degrees. The distance from the Sun to each source in this schedule is: Source Sun distance (deg) FAKERA 90.7 3C286 143.1 3C84 51.7 OJ287 119.8 1641+399 109.0 Barry Clark estimates from predictions by Ketan Desai of IPM scattering sizes that the Sun will cause amplitude reductions on the longest VLBA baselines at a solar distance of 60deg F^(-0.6) where F is in GHz. For common VLBI bands, this is: 327 MHz 117. deg 610 MHz 81. deg 1.6 GHz 45. deg 2.3 GHz 36. deg 5.0 GHz 23. deg 8.4 GHz 17. deg 15.0 GHz 12. deg 22.0 GHz 9. deg 43.0 GHz 6. deg
